A Seminar on Men Opposed to Violence Against Women Everywhere (MOVE) was successfully conducted earlier this morning at the NPD Conference Room, Tanigue St., corner Dagat-Dagatan Avenue, Caloocan City.
The activity was led by the Deputy District Director for Administration, PCOL AMANTE B DARO, under the supervision of the District Director, NPD, PBGEN JOSEFINO D LIGAN.
The seminar aimed to raise awareness among NPD personnel about the important role of men in preventing violence against women. It also encouraged police officers to become advocates for respect, equality, and safety, not only in their workplaces but also inside their own homes and communities they serve.
This is part of the NPD’s continuous efforts to promote gender sensitivity and to strengthen the campaign to end violence against women.
